Kickoff Time, Broadcast Info Announced for WVU’s Regular-Season Finale Against Oklahoma
West Virginia and Oklahoma will kick off at noon next Saturday, Dec. 12, when the teams meet in Morgantown to play their rescheduled matchup from two weeks ago.

The Big 12 announced Sunday the game will start at noon and will be broadcast on ESPN.
The original game between the Mountaineers and Sooners was scheduled to be WVU’s first night game in two seasons, kicking off at 7 p.m. That game was postponed due to positive COVID tests at Oklahoma and rescheduled to Dec. 12.
West Virginia is 5-4, 4-4 in the Big 12 coming off of a loss to Iowa State. Oklahoma is 7-2, 6-2, and secured a spot in the Big 12 championship game on Dec. 19 with a win over Baylor this week.
The game will be WVU’s final 2020 regular-season game and will serve as senior day for the Mountaineers.
